From f88c97c1332d6d760d193ce3d76765f8105b1cda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: =?utf8?q?Uwe=20Kleine-K=C3=B6nig?= <u.kleine-koenig@pengutronix.de> Date: Fri, 3 Jun 2022 23:07:58 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] mtd: physmap: Drop if with an always false condition M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=utf8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it The remove callback is only called after probe completed successfully. In this case platform_set_drvdata() was called with a non-NULL argument and so info is never NULL. This is a preparation for making platform remove callbacks return void.
